Aura Biosciences, Inc. operates as a biotechnology company that focuses on developing therapies to combat cancer, specifically through its innovative virus-like drug conjugates (VDC) technology platform. This platform targets tumors in areas of high unmet need, particularly within ocular and urologic oncology. The company is advancing AU-011, a promising VDC candidate aimed at treating primary choroidal melanoma, and is also exploring its application in other ocular oncology conditions, such as choroidal metastases. BOSTON, May 15,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Aura Biosciences, Inc. (“Aura”) (Nasdaq: AURA), a clinical-stage biotechnology company developing precision therapies for solid tumors designed to preserve organ function, today announced the pricing of an underwritten public offering consisting of (i) 11,735,565 shares of its common stock and accompanying warrants to purchase an aggregate of 2,933,891 shares of common stock and (ii) to certain investors, pre-funded warrants to purchase an aggregate of up to 3,571,435 shares of its common stock at an exercise price of $0.00001 per pre-funded warrant, and accompanying warrants to purchase up to 892,858 shares of its common stock. The common stock and pre-funded warrants are being sold in combination with an accompanying warrant to purchase 0.25 of a share of common stock issued for each share of common stock or pre-funded warrant sold. The accompanying common stock warrant has an exercise price of $4.90 per share, is immediately exercisable from the date of issuance and will expire five years from the date of issuance. The combined offering price of each share of common stock and accompanying common stock warrant is $4.90. The combined offering price of each pre-funded warrant and accompanying common stock warrant is $4.89999.

BOSTON, April 02,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Aura Biosciences, Inc. (NASDAQ: AURA), a clinical-stage biotechnology company developing precision therapies for solid tumors designed to preserve organ function, today announced the appointment of Teresa Bitetti, President of the Global Oncology Business Unit at Takeda, to the Company's Board of Directors, effective March 31, 2025.

Aura will Participate in the Research Forum at the 40th Annual European Association of Urology Congress Aura will Host a Virtual Urologic Oncology Investor Event Featuring Key Opinion Leaders at 4:30 pm Eastern Time on March 24, 2025 BOSTON, March 03,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Aura Biosciences, Inc. (NASDAQ: AURA), a clinical-stage biotechnology company developing precision therapies for solid tumors designed to preserve organ function, today announced that additional Phase 1 data evaluating bel-sar (AU-011) for the treatment of patients with non-muscle invasive bladder cancer (NMIBC) will be presented at the 40th Annual European Association of Urology (EAU) Congress being held March 21-24, 2025, in Madrid, Spain. Aura will also participate in the EAU Research Forum during the Congress.
